Heroin is an extremely powerful and highly addictive drug that has the potential to inflict grievous harm on individuals who abuse it. A member of the opioid family, heroin initially creates an intense rush of euphoria when abused, along with a decrease in blood pressure and respiration. Addiction, or heroin use disorder, can occur quickly and is accompanied by a need for increasingly larger or more potent doses, which raises the risk of overdose. When a person with heroin use disorder attempts to stop abusing the drug, he or she will likely experience a series of distressing physical and psychological symptoms within a few hours. These withdrawal symptoms can make it virtually impossible for a person to end his or her dependence upon heroin without effective treatment from a reputable addiction rehab center.

Inpatient Rehab Facilities vs. Outpatient Addiction Clinics in Silver City, MS
When selecting a heroin treatment center, you have the option of choosing between an inpatient facility and an outpatient clinic. Individual treatment needs are naturally going to vary, and there are certain benefits (and drawbacks) to both types of treatment for heroin addiction that may inform the decision for treatment type.
Outpatient facilities can vary widely. Many outpatient rehabs provide treatment in the form of education, group therapy, individual therapy, and in some cases, access to psychiatric care or medication assisted treatment. Outpatient programs range in levels of intensity and, to some extent, the treatment plan can be tailored to each client, with the number and type of scheduled weekly groups varying based on the individual’s needs.
The time commitment can be substantial in an inpatient (residential) rehab setting, and studies suggest that a minimum of 90 days in treatment is essential for successful outcomes and long-term sobriety. Due to the tenacious nature of heroin addiction and the many facets of an individual’s life it affects, an inpatient treatment program is commonly sought.
Heroin is highly addictive, both mentally and physically. Those who attempt to quit often suffer from a withdrawal period that can be extremely uncomfortable. A benefit of many inpatient treatment programs is that they commonly include some form of medically supervised detox and around-the-clock support to keep those recovering a safe and comfortable as possible—minimizing relapse risks.

Heroin Detox in Silver City, MS
The next step in the heroin rehab is detox from heroin. The main objective of detox is to relieve your withdrawal symptoms while your body adjusts to functioning without the drug. Detox from heroin should be completed under medical supervision.
The type of detox program will depend on the facility chosen. Some facilities choose to ease the detox process through medication-assisted treatment. Providing tapering doses of replacement medications such as Suboxone (buprenorphine and naloxone), buprenorphine, or methadone can reduce the symptoms of withdrawal in a safe, medically monitored setting.
Another type of detox method is abstinence-only or social detox. With this type of detox, there is no replacement drug, and the patient will simply stop using the drug, with no opioid replacement support to minimize the symptoms of withdrawal. Many find this form of detox quite challenging in cases of heroin withdrawal. More recently, medication assisted detox is becoming an increasingly common method for managing heroin dependence.

How Do I Find Help for a Heroin Addiction in Silver City, MS?
Heroin rehab programs provide effective treatment and support for people addicted to heroin. Comprehensive heroin rehab is offered in a number of treatment settings, including both inpatient and outpatient. Many rehabs for heroin or other opioid drugs include a detox program at the start of treatment. Then the patient receives a combination of therapeutic interventions, such as individual therapy, group counseling, family therapy, peer support groups, and more, to help rectify drug-using behaviors and avoid relapse.
